Digital to Analog Converters (DAC) Analog Devices, Inc. MAX5152BEEE+ Overview

The MAX5152BEEE+ from Analog Devices, Inc. stands out in the market of Digital to Analog Converters (DAC) due to its precise 13-bit resolution and compact 16QSOP packaging. This high-performance IC is designed to meet the rigorous demands of advanced electronics, providing reliable and stable voltage outputs essential for critical applications. The integration of dual DAC channels enhances its utility in multi-channel applications, making it an ideal choice for both industrial and consumer technology sectors. With its high accuracy and low power consumption, the Digital to Analog Converters (DAC) Analog Devices, Inc. MAX5152BEEE+ is tailored to deliver exceptional performance where precision voltage conversion is required.

MAX5152BEEE+ Features

This integrated circuit boasts a robust set of features tailored for high precision tasks. Key attributes include dual 13-bit DAC outputs, which allow for simultaneous output of two analog signals from digital input, providing greater flexibility in complex applications. The IC operates with a low supply voltage from +2.7V to +5.5V, minimizing power consumption while maintaining output accuracy. Additionally, the MAX5152BEEE+ offers an extended temperature range, making it suitable for varied environmental conditions, and its compact QSOP package ensures it can be integrated into space-constrained applications without sacrificing performance.
